Wine Tastings
Consider attending wine tastings. Wine tastings are events that allow you to try out different types of wines for a lower cost. This can even become a social event. Have your wine loving friends come along. You may develop a better relationship with those you love while also enjoying something that you love.

Consider having a wine cellar to make sure your wines last the life span that they’re made for. You definitely need this if you plan on storing your expensive wine for a long time in a location other than your kitchen. The cost of the cellar will more than pay for itself when it keeps your expensive wines from going bad.
Anytime you purchase wine, your personal taste should be the most important factor. Many professionals will tell you that one bottle is better than another because of region or winery, but in the end, it all comes down to taste preference. If you prefer a low cost white wine, then buy it. The important thing, above all else, is to indulge in a wine that you truly enjoy.

As you explore a wine for the first time, try to pick out each note and flavor. Concentrate hard, and you may pick out a note of fruit or flowers. There are also other hidden aromas from additional ingredients that can be detected by your senses. Be on the lookout for these aromas, and soon, you’ll be able to recognize them faster.
